Ferrari
F12tdf by Vitesse AuDessus
Vitesse
AuDessus has announced plans to offer a full carbon fiber body for the recently
introduced Ferrari F12tdf. The
F12 Tour de France is already 110 kg lighter than the Berlinetta, but
a full carbon fiber body can reduce weight even further. Once the panels are
replaced, the F12tdf will lose almost 159 kg, so it will end up
tipping the scales at around 1,256 kg.
Vitesse
AuDessus ("superior speed" in French) says it will only make five
bodies and each will be tailor-made. The good news for owners is the process is
reversible so once you’ve had enough of the carbon look you can switch back to
the car’s original configuration.
The
US-based company has similar packages for a plethora of high-end automobiles,
including the Porsche 918 Spyder, LaFerrari, and the mighty Bugatti Veyron.
Depending on the car and the client’s requirements, Vitesse AuDessus is asking
between US$ 100,000 and US$ 200,000 for the exterior. At an additional cost, carbon
fiber can be applied on some of the cabin parts and you can also get the wheels
made from the same material.
Just
like with the other kits, the Vitesse AuDessus Louboutin Limited Edition Bare
Carbon Fiber Package for the Ferrari F12tdf comes with a five-year warranty.
